  • As far as the builder teleological argument. Besides the obvious issues, its not just that we have a building (premise A) that shows there was a builder (conclusion). Its that we have seen builders (premise B) that lead us to this fact. If I had never known of builders, to say this building in front of me was built by a builder, would be scientifically empty.

  • Premise C would be that all buildings need builders (and intelligent ones), which is itself an assumption unless proven, and would answer the conclusion already, making the argument circular i.e. illogical). But even if we had A, B, and C for the explanation of the universe, it still wouldn't be logical to then assume the conclusion. It has never been a good argument.
